Warning Signs You Need Document Drying Services in Hickory Creek, TX

Becoming aware of the warning signs of document damage is crucial in preventing permanent loss. If you notice any of the following, don’t hesitate to contact our team for help. We’re here to help and will work with you to restore your documents.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ore the smell it’s a sign that your documents are at risk. Musty odors are a common indicator of water damage, and if left unchecked, can lead to permanent damage. Our team will work with you to identify the source of the odor and develop a plan to restore your documents.

Visible Water Stains or Warping

Water stains are a warning sign that your documents are at risk. If you notice any visible signs of water damage, don’t wait, contact our team immediately. We’ll work with you to ass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your documents.

Paper or Cardstock Discoloration

Discoloration is a sign of damage don’t ignore it. If your documents are showing signs of discoloration, it’s likely a sign that they’ve been exposed to water. Our team will work with you to ass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your documents.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old and mildew are serious threats to your documents. If you notice any signs of mold or mildew growth, don’t wait, contact our team immediately. We’ll work with you to ass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your documents.

Document Weakening or Brittle Texture

Weakened documents are at risk of further damage. If you notice any signs of weakening or a brittle texture, it’s likely a sign that your documents have been exposed to water. Our team will work with you to ass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your documents.

Document Shrinkage or Warping

Shrinkage and warping are signs of damage don’t ignore them. If your documents are showing signs of shrinkage or warping, it’s likely a sign that they’ve been exposed to water. Our team will work with you to ass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your documents.

Document Drying Services Cost in Hickory Creek, TX

The cost of Document Drying Services in Hickory Creek, TX varies dep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our prices are estimates and may vary based on local conditions and the specific needs of your documents. We understand that every situation is unique, and we’ll work with you to develop a personalized plan that meets your need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small Document Drying Service (1-10 documents) $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Medium Document Drying Service (11-50 documents) $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Large Document Drying Service (51+ documents) $2,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Emergency Document Drying Service (24/7) $200 – $1,000 Severity of damage, urgency of situation
Document Storage and Handling $50 – $200 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Document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
